Owning the room - Raising your profile with your external voice
Our next Female Counsel session will take place at 9.30am on Thursday 19th March.
Senior lawyers are often highly respected within their organisations, yet their external visibility does not always reflect the depth of their expertise.
This session explores how to intentionally shape and strengthen your personal brand through external communication and thought leadership, whether on conference panels, at industry events, or national media.
We will cover how to identify what you want to be known for, how to become a genuinely useful and credible contributor, how to overcome common barriers to visibility, how to generate relevant and compelling content, and how to perform confidently and authentically in the moment.
The session is practical, strategic and focused on helping participants translate their expertise into influence.
The session will be run by Abi Donald, head coach at Vox, a communications coaching company based in London.
Having advised global CEOs, professional services partners and leadership teams on high-stakes communications for over a decade, and previously serving as a senior editor at Reuters, ITN and ITV News, Abi brings first-hand insight into how reputations are built, and how authoritative voices are recognised.

Creating a Safer City For All
Our next Female Counsel session will be a virtual one and will take place at 9.30am on 2 October.
We will be joined by Heather Butler, Sarah Jane Cork and Charlotte Hopkins. They will lead our discussion on...
‘How we can work together to create a safer city for everyone.’
We all want to ensure that we work and live in as safe a city as possible.
Heather and Sarah are ambassadors of Our Safer City which is an incredible organisation. Their mission is to help prevent violence against women and girls, forming alliances with relevant public and private companies in the City of London to create a framework which can ultimately be adopted nationally.
Topics we’ll cover in the session:
💡 Introduction to Our Safer City – background, vision, and current initiatives
💡 Services and support available – what’s on offer and how these may be relevant to you, your clients, and your community
💡 Insights from the Steering Group – perspectives from professionals in the field and survivors of abuse on how individuals and organisations can make a difference
💡 The legal perspective – how professionals can drive positive change in the workplace and beyond
